PipelineForJenkins/Jenkinsfile - SRP Violation Analysis
Pipeline Role: Orchestration only (sequence/flow control)
SRP Violation: If inline code exists in Jenkinsfile, it violates orchestration-only principle
1. SRP Violation Analysis Criteria
- Jenkinsfile Role: Orchestration (pipeline sequence/flow control)
- SRP Violation Condition: If actual logic exists in Jenkinsfile (not Helper calls)
- Analysis Method: Stage-by-Stage inline code detection

3. Inline Code Details by Stage
Prepare Workspace stage (1 inline code)
script {
dir("${PROJECT_DIR}") {
try {
// Helper calls...
} catch (Exception e) { // Inline: try-catch error handling
echo "Error in Prepare Workspace stage: ${e.getMessage()}"
currentBuild.result = buildResults.FAILURE
error("Workspace preparation failed: ${e.getMessage()}")
}
}
}
Lint Groovy Code stage (6 inline codes) - Most Severe

Static Analysis stage (2 inline codes)
// SonarQube scanner config (Inline 1)
script {
catchError(buildResults: buildResults.SUCCESS, stageResults: stageResults.FAILURE) { // Note: typo in parameter names
String scannerHome = tool SONARQUBE_SCANNER
withSonarQubeEnv(SONARQUBE_SERVER) {
String sonarCommand = "\"${scannerHome}/bin/sonar-scanner\" " +
"\"-Dsonar.projectKey=${env.SONAR_PROJECT_KEY}\" " +
'\"-Dsonar.host.url=http://localhost:9000/sonarqube\" ' +
// ... more options
sh sonarCommand
}
}
}
// Quality Gate check logic (Inline 2)
script {
catchError(buildResults: buildResults.SUCCESS, stageResults: stageResults.FAILURE) {
Map status = generalUtil.checkQualityGateStatus(SONAR_PROJECT_KEY, env.SONAR_QUBE_AUTH_TOKEN)
if ((status.entireCodeStatus != STATUS_OK) || (status.newCodeStatus != STATUS_OK)) {
error('Quality gate failed!')
}
}
}

Conclusion
SRP Violation: - Total 14 inline codes across 6 stages - Lint Groovy Code Stage: Most severe (6 inline codes, Groovy/Jenkinsfile same pattern duplicated) - Static Analysis Stage: SonarQube scanner config directly in Jenkinsfile - Key difference from other pipelines: Docker container for linting, Gradle/Groovydoc commands - Bug:
catchErrorparameter typo (buildResults→buildResult,stageResults→stageResult) - Recommendation: Extract lint logic to Helper function, fix catchError typo
